Totally useful, because I've got a 20+mb GetCaps document, which is
really insane to use on the client.
I can't do anything about it now, because my basemap is a layer group,
and everything else sits inside workspaces.
So a client app has to get root getcaps anyways.

The only solution I have is to move the basemap layers and layer group
to another GeoServer instance. Thats uncool, but no other variants.

>> Although I do think this could be useful. I think having layer groups and
>> styles be contained within a workspace would be the last step to actually
>> having per workspace/virtual services. Well that and service configuration
>> per workspace as well.
